6lowpan: iphc: add support for stateful compression
This patch introduce support for IPHC stateful address compression. It will offer the context table via one debugfs entry. This debugfs has and directory for each cid entry for the context table. Inside each cid directory there exists the following files: - "active": If the entry is added or deleted. The context table is original a list implementation, this flag will indicate if the context is part of list or not. - "prefix": The ipv6 prefix. - "prefix_length": The prefix length for the prefix. - "compression": The compression flag according RFC6775. This part should be moved into sysfs after some testing time. Also the debugfs entry contains a "show" file which is a pretty-printout for the current context table information.
